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ain global benefit programs
  • Evaluate, create, and maintain Lyft’s leave of absence programs
  • Manage broker and vendor relationships and serve as corporate liaison to resolve issues and implement changes 
  • Support with implementation of benefit functionality in HR systems, manage system accuracy on an ongoing basis
  • Lead trainings and discussions with senior management team 
  • Manage benefit budget and forecast
  • Gather feedback from internal stakeholders and conduct market research for decisions on  program design
  • Create/maintain benefit policies and provide recommendation on best practices
  • Ensure global plan compliance
  • Stay on top of benefit trends, best practice, and regulatory updates
  • Partner with internal teams (Payroll, Finance, Legal, etc.) in benefit program creation, maintenance, communication, education
  • Be a conduit for the benefit value proposition and maintain strong partnership with all team members

Benefits:

  • Great medical, dental, and vision insurance options
  • Mental health benefits
  • In addition to 12 observed holidays, salaried team members have unlimited paid time off, hourly team members have 15 days paid time off
  • 401(k) plan to help save for your future
  • 18 weeks of paid parental leave. Biological, adoptive, and foster parents are all eligible
  • Pre-tax commuter benefits
  • Lyft Pink - Lyft team members get an exclusive opportunity to test new benefits of our Ridership Program
